Objectives

The main objective of the curricular unit is to provide education and training in the field of ocean affairs and law of the sea. At the end of the curricular unit students should be able, based on acquired knowledge, to comment cases and discuss specific situations.

Teaching Methodologies

Teaching is composed by a mix of theoretical and practical classes. The exposition of each subject of the syllabus is then done by the teacher during the theoretical classes. Practical classes are aimed at solving exercises, commenting cases and discussing specific situations. Evaluation is based upon two written exams.
